The meat pen class had 21 pens in it. I was shuffled around a bit, and not sure what was gonna happen. The judge put money in front of them, and with this judge, that's a good thing! In the end, my pen had one that caught them off and had them taken off. I got 7th place! I had one little girl weak in the hind quarters, that's not something that will ever fill out. So she's one that will have to leave. The other two very uniform in type and body. They weighed in at 4.3, 4.3, 4.6 good weights!
The Single Fryer class also had 21 rabbits in it. I had entered the one rabbit that had made my pen lose position on the table. I had entered the weak hind quarters girl. The judge went about looking and re-looking at them. He put them in the order he wanted and just went down the table. I got 6th place with my little girl. Far better than I ever expected!
I asked the judge to look at all three and tell me which was the best. He told me what I expected after that! But he also told me why he said what he said. So I know which one I'm keeping! Mom might let me do this again!
